Additional information

The full, rigorous modelling of the optical electromagnetic fields combined with the accurate modelling of liquid crystal behaviour presented here has not been done before and allows accurate design of complex, liquid crystal-tuneable photonic devices. The refractive index change possible with this technique is two orders of magnitude higher than that achieved using semiconductors non-linearities or the piezoelectric effect. Collaborators at Ghent University have demonstrated tuneable optical ring resonators and couplers with liquid crystal cladding using our modelling methods as design tools. The work has led to further collaboration with Prof. A. d’Alessandro, University of Rome.
